/**
|
|
* @brief Convert the NoteType to a beat representation.
|
|
* @param nt the NoteType to check.
|
|
* @return the proper beat.
|
|
*/
|
|
float NoteTypeToBeat( NoteType nt )
|
|
{
|
|
switch( nt )
|
|
{
|
|
case NOTE_TYPE_4TH: return 1.0f; // quarter notes
|
|
case NOTE_TYPE_8TH: return 1.0f/2; // eighth notes
|
|
case NOTE_TYPE_12TH: return 1.0f/3; // quarter note triplets
|
|
case NOTE_TYPE_16TH: return 1.0f/4; // sixteenth notes
|
|
case NOTE_TYPE_24TH: return 1.0f/6; // eighth note triplets
|
|
case NOTE_TYPE_32ND: return 1.0f/8; // thirty-second notes
|
|
case NOTE_TYPE_48TH: return 1.0f/12; // sixteenth note triplets
|
|
case NOTE_TYPE_64TH: return 1.0f/16; // sixty-fourth notes
|
|
case NOTE_TYPE_192ND: return 1.0f/48; // sixty-fourth note triplets
|
|
case NoteType_Invalid: return 1.0f/48;
|
|
default:
|
|
FAIL_M(ssprintf("Unrecognized note type: %i", nt));
|
|
}
|
|
}
|
|
|
|
int NoteTypeToRow( NoteType nt )
|
|
{
|
|
switch( nt )
|
|
{
|
|
case NOTE_TYPE_4TH: return 48;
|
|
case NOTE_TYPE_8TH: return 24;
|
|
case NOTE_TYPE_12TH: return 16;
|
|
case NOTE_TYPE_16TH: return 12;
|
|
case NOTE_TYPE_24TH: return 8;
|
|
case NOTE_TYPE_32ND: return 6;
|
|
case NOTE_TYPE_48TH: return 4;
|
|
case NOTE_TYPE_64TH: return 3;
|
|
case NOTE_TYPE_192ND:
|
|
case NoteType_Invalid:
|
|
return 1;
|
|
default:
|
|
FAIL_M("Invalid note type found: cannot convert to row.");
|
|
}
|
|
}

/**
|
|
* @brief The number of beats per measure.
|
|
*
|
|
* FIXME: Look at the time signature of the song and use that instead at some point. */
|
|
static const int BEATS_PER_MEASURE = 4;
|
|
/**
|
|
* @brief The number of rows used in a measure.
|
|
*
|
|
* FIXME: Similar to the above, use time signatures and don't force hard-coded values. */
|
|
static const int ROWS_PER_MEASURE = ROWS_PER_BEAT * BEATS_PER_MEASURE;
|
|
|
|
/**
|
|
* @brief Retrieve the proper quantized NoteType for the note.
|
|
* @param row The row to check for.
|
|
* @return the quantized NoteType. */
|
|
NoteType GetNoteType( int row )
|
|
{
|
|
if( row % (ROWS_PER_MEASURE/4) == 0) return NOTE_TYPE_4TH;
|
|
else if( row % (ROWS_PER_MEASURE/8) == 0) return NOTE_TYPE_8TH;
|
|
else if( row % (ROWS_PER_MEASURE/12) == 0) return NOTE_TYPE_12TH;
|
|
else if( row % (ROWS_PER_MEASURE/16) == 0) return NOTE_TYPE_16TH;
|
|
else if( row % (ROWS_PER_MEASURE/24) == 0) return NOTE_TYPE_24TH;
|
|
else if( row % (ROWS_PER_MEASURE/32) == 0) return NOTE_TYPE_32ND;
|
|
else if( row % (ROWS_PER_MEASURE/48) == 0) return NOTE_TYPE_48TH;
|
|
else if( row % (ROWS_PER_MEASURE/64) == 0) return NOTE_TYPE_64TH;
|
|
else return NOTE_TYPE_192ND;
|
|
};
|
|
|
|
NoteType BeatToNoteType( float fBeat )
|
|
{
|
|
return GetNoteType( BeatToNoteRow(fBeat) );
|
|
}
|
|
/**
|
|
* @brief Determine if the row has a particular type of quantized note.
|
|
* @param row the row in the Steps.
|
|
* @param t the quantized NoteType to check for.
|
|
* @return true if the NoteType is t, false otherwise.
|
|
*/
|
|
bool IsNoteOfType( int row, NoteType t )
|
|
{
|
|
return GetNoteType(row) == t;
|
|
}
